Outschool Unveils AI-Powered Tool to Streamline Teacher Progress Report Writing

Outschool, the innovative online learning platform known for its engaging classes for kids, has announced the launch of its AI Teaching Assistant—a powerful tool designed to help tutors effortlessly create progress reports. Primarily recognized for its small group courses, Outschool is now expanding into one-on-one tutoring, positioning itself as a competitor to established services like Varsity Tutors, Tutor.com, and Preply.

Amir Nathoo, co-founder and CEO of Outschool, shared with us that the AI Teaching Assistant is powered by a collaboration with OpenAI. Since the release of ChatGPT in 2022, OpenAI has sparked significant discussions among educators, with concerns surrounding cheating and plagiarism counterbalanced by recognition of its ability to streamline administrative tasks for teachers.

The new AI feature is crafted to assist instructors in efficiently generating progress reports and fostering communication with parents or caregivers. After each session, tutors input key bullet points into the AI Teaching Assistant, which then composes a detailed overview of the student’s activities and performance. Tutors can choose to send either a thorough report or a brief summary.

We had the opportunity to speak with Melanie Pauli, a piano instructor with over 25 years of teaching experience who joined Outschool in 2020. As an early user of the AI tool during its beta phase, she found that generating reports took less than five minutes, allowing her to save valuable time between lessons.

"Before this, I communicated directly with students," Pauli explained. "Now, sending messages to parents not only keeps them informed but may also enhance customer retention, as they feel involved in the learning journey."

Currently, this feature is available exclusively to tutors conducting private lessons, but Outschool has indicated that it may adapt the tool for group classes if demand increases.

Outschool has also launched one-on-one tutoring, an astute move in response to the rising popularity of online education following the COVID-19 pandemic. According to Grand View Research, the online tutoring market is expected to reach a value of $23.73 billion by 2030.

Nathoo emphasized the importance of personalized support for students, stating, "It has been challenging for parents and teachers to address learning gaps since the pandemic. One-on-one tutoring is a valuable resource for parents seeking academic assistance for their children."

Since its inception in 2015, Outschool has engaged over one million learners in more than 100,000 live online classes, catering to students aged three to 18. The introduction of one-on-one sessions will also enable Outschool tutors to increase their earning potential by charging higher rates for personalized instruction. With a robust network of over 4,000 educators, Outschool covers a diverse array of subjects including English, math, art, and music.

Outschool is making significant strides in the education technology space, evidenced by recent funding rounds (Series B, C, and D) and a strategic restructuring involving an 18% workforce reduction.
